The introduction of digital sports streaming platforms has radically shaped the way viewers consume sporting coverage worldwide. These revolutionary platforms have democratised access historically exclusive showings, enabling audiences to enjoy games and events from virtually anywhere with a web connection. Top streaming services have allocated billions in obtaining broadcasting permissions for top-tier athletic competitions, fueling fierce competition between service providers. The flexibility afforded by these platforms allows enthusiasts to tailor their watching experience through options such as multiple camera angles, instant replays, and personalised content recommendations. Commentary and sports analysis has evolved notably with the incorporation of advanced technological resources and information analytics. Modern analysts currently have accessibility to real-time statistics, player monitoring data, and complex analytical tools that enhances their capacity to provide valuable observations during broadcasts. The complexity of evaluation accessible has shifted commentary from straightforward play-by-play accounts to in-depth tactical analyses that educate viewers. Advanced graphics packages enable commentators to demonstrate complex tactics and player actions with visual aids that make the game more accessible to informal viewers. Live sports coverage has absolutely been revolutionised through cutting-edge broadcast tools delivering unprecedented image and audio quality to viewers. Ultra-high-definition cameras, advanced microphone systems, and refined production tools allow production crews to capture every instant of sporting action with remarkable accuracy. The use of virtual reality and augmented reality technologies has offer immersive watching experiences that place viewers almost within stadiums and venues. Drone equipment has effectively broadened the artistic options for recording sky footage and unique angles previously unachievable or remarkably costly. Real-time data synergy allows broadcasters to overlay statistics, athlete details, and tactical breakdowns immediately onto the real-time feed, establishing a more informative viewing experience.
